Airborne Range Hawks: Expanding Hypersonic Flight Test Capabilities

In the world of aviation, the pursuit of faster and more efficient flight has always been a driving force. Over the years, we have witnessed remarkable advancements in aircraft technology, from the first powered flight by the Wright brothers to supersonic jets like the Concorde. However, the latest frontier in aviation is hypersonic flight, which promises to revolutionize air travel and military operations. To push the boundaries of hypersonic flight, researchers and engineers are turning to innovative solutions like Airborne Range Hawks.

Airborne Range Hawks are specialized aircraft that are designed to expand hypersonic flight test capabilities. These aircraft serve as flying laboratories, allowing scientists and engineers to gather crucial data and insights into the behavior and performance of hypersonic vehicles. By conducting flight tests at high altitudes and speeds, Airborne Range Hawks play a vital role in advancing our understanding of hypersonic flight and developing technologies that can withstand the extreme conditions associated with it.

One of the key advantages of Airborne Range Hawks is their ability to provide a controlled environment for testing hypersonic vehicles. These aircraft are equipped with state-of-the-art instrumentation and sensors that can measure various parameters such as temperature, pressure, and aerodynamic forces. This data is essential for evaluating the performance and safety of hypersonic vehicles, as well as identifying any potential issues or areas for improvement.

Moreover, Airborne Range Hawks offer a unique advantage over ground-based testing facilities. While ground-based facilities can simulate certain aspects of hypersonic flight, they cannot replicate the dynamic conditions experienced during actual flight. Airborne Range Hawks, on the other hand, can fly alongside or in close proximity to hypersonic vehicles, allowing researchers to observe their behavior in real-time. This real-world testing provides invaluable insights into the complex interactions between the vehicle and its environment, enabling engineers to refine their designs and optimize performance.

Another significant benefit of Airborne Range Hawks is their versatility. These aircraft can be modified and adapted to accommodate different types of hypersonic vehicles, making them a cost-effective solution for conducting a wide range of flight tests. By utilizing Airborne Range Hawks, researchers can avoid the need for building dedicated ground-based facilities for each specific test, saving both time and resources.

Furthermore, Airborne Range Hawks can also serve as a platform for testing new technologies and systems that are crucial for hypersonic flight. For example, researchers can use these aircraft to evaluate advanced materials that can withstand the extreme temperatures generated during hypersonic flight. They can also test innovative propulsion systems and control mechanisms that are essential for achieving stable and controlled hypersonic flight.

In conclusion, Airborne Range Hawks are playing a pivotal role in expanding our understanding of hypersonic flight and pushing the boundaries of aviation technology. These specialized aircraft provide a controlled environment for testing hypersonic vehicles, allowing researchers to gather crucial data and insights. With their ability to fly alongside or in close proximity to hypersonic vehicles, Airborne Range Hawks offer a unique advantage over ground-based testing facilities. Their versatility and adaptability make them a cost-effective solution for conducting a wide range of flight tests. As we continue to explore the possibilities of hypersonic flight, Airborne Range Hawks will undoubtedly play a vital role in shaping the future of aviation.
